Frequently Asked Questions About Nursing Homes in Holmdel, New Jersey
Does Medicaid or Medicare pay for nursing homes in Holmdel, New Jersey?
Medicaid and Medicare provide different types of coverage for nursing home care in Holmdel, New Jersey, and understanding their distinctions is crucial. Medicare may cover short-term stays in a skilled nursing facility if certain conditions are met, such as a prior hospital stay of at least three days and the need for skilled nursing or rehabilitation services. This coverage is typically limited to up to 100 days per benefit period, with the first 20 days fully covered and co-payments required for days 21 through 100. Medicaid, on the other hand, is designed for long-term care and can cover the full cost of nursing home care for eligible individuals with low income and assets. Medicaid eligibility requires meeting specific financial and medical criteria, and the program may pay for both personal and medical care services in a nursing home. It is essential to contact a Medicaid specialist for guidance on eligibility and application processes.
What factors should be considered when choosing a nursing home in Holmdel, New Jersey?
When choosing a nursing home in Holmdel, New Jersey, several critical factors should be evaluated to ensure the best possible care and living conditions. First, consider the facility's reputation and reviews from residents and their families, which can provide insight into the quality of care and overall satisfaction. Visit the nursing home to inspect the cleanliness, safety features, and general atmosphere. Check for the availability of specialized care services that may be needed, such as memory care for dementia patients. Assess the qualifications and experience of the staff, including nurses and caregivers, and verify their training and certification. Additionally, evaluate the types of amenities and activities offered, as these can significantly impact the residents' quality of life. Ensure that the facility complies with state regulations and has up-to-date licensing and accreditation. Finally, review the cost and payment options, including whether the facility accepts Medicare or Medicaid, to ensure it aligns with your financial situation.

What types of financial assistance are available for nursing home care in Holmdel, New Jersey?
In Holmdel, New Jersey, several types of financial assistance may be available to help cover the cost of nursing home care. Medicare may provide limited coverage for nursing home care if certain conditions are met, such as a hospital stay of at least three days before admission and the need for skilled nursing care. Medicaid, a joint federal and state program, offers more extensive coverage for long-term nursing home care for eligible individuals with low income and assets. To qualify for Medicaid, you must meet specific financial criteria and may need to spend down assets or income to meet eligibility requirements. Additionally, there may be veterans' benefits for those who have served in the military, which can help with nursing home costs. Some long-term care insurance policies may also cover nursing home expenses, depending on the terms of the policy. It's advisable to consult with a financial advisor or elder law attorney to explore all available options and determine the best approach for your situation.
How do nursing homes in HOLMDEL handle specialized care needs such as dementia or mobility issues?
Nursing homes in HOLMDEL can address specialized care needs such as dementia or mobility issues by offering tailored programs and services designed to meet the unique requirements of these conditions. For residents with dementia, some facilities provide specialized memory care units or programs that focus on creating a secure environment, offering structured routines, and utilizing therapeutic activities that enhance cognitive function and quality of life. Staff members in these units often receive additional training in dementia care techniques to manage behavioral symptoms and support residents effectively. For mobility issues, nursing homes may offer physical therapy services to help improve or maintain mobility. The facility should be equipped with assistive devices like wheelchairs, walkers, and grab bars, and staff should be trained in proper techniques for transferring and assisting residents with mobility challenges. Additionally, facilities may implement safety measures to prevent falls and accidents, such as clear pathways and adaptive equipment. It's important to discuss these specific needs with the nursing home during your visit to ensure they have the appropriate resources and expertise to provide the necessary care.
